Richard John Carew Chartres, Baron Chartres GCVO, ChStJ, PC, FSA, FBS is a retired bishop of the Church of England. He was area Bishop of Stepney from 1992 to 1995 and Bishop of London from 1995 to 2024. He was sworn of the Privy Council in the same year he became Bishop of London. WebFeb 26, 2024 · Chartres Cathedral, also known as the Cathedral of Our Lady of Chartres (Cathédral Notre-Dame de Chartres), is a Roman Catholic church in Chartres, France, ands is the seat of the Bishop of Chartres. It is in the High Gothic and Romanesque styles.
